For the weekly sync: the Fernline field-survey app now ships an offline mode that caches survey forms and queues submissions locally. Provenance matters here because offline bundles are signed at build time and verified on reconnect; an unsigned bundle silently drops queued submissions. All offline-capable builds come from the Copperhollow hermetic pipeline, never developer laptops. Verification steps run automatically in CI, and results attach to the artifact. The current provenance token appears below.

session token of tajef-bageg = htk21_5d90d574934f3ccae6437

Onboarding: ChipGate Reader — Tarnby Marathon Systems

For the weekly eng sync: new folks should know the ChipGate reader polls each timing mat every 50ms and buffers splits locally if the uplink drops. Firmware updates go through Mira's staging rig, never directly to race-day units. Calibration logs live in the ops share. If the reader's admin console locks after three failed attempts, restore access with the recovery passphrase below.

unlock words, kagef-taduf: fenir-quenix-norwyn-sorvan-gormir-gorir-fraok

Facilities Ticket — Cleaning Crew Access, Brindle Annex

For new starters handling evening lock-up: the Sorano Cleaning crew arrives nightly at 21:30 via the annex side door. Check their rota sheet, note arrival in the log, and ensure the storeroom is relocked afterward. To let them through the side door, enter the access code below.

badge for yaweg-hafog: bdg-GX-6

Before archiving a cold storage bucket in Glacierette, detach all plugin hooks. Run the freeze job, confirm checksum parity, then revoke scoped tokens. Do not delete manifests; the Vexhall recovery service reads them during account restoration. If the bucket owner's account is locked, trigger the recovery flow from the Opsgate console, not the plugin API. Archival completes within 20 minutes. Plugins must tolerate 404s on frozen objects. To unseal the restore job, use the passphrase below.

vault phrase of fawig-yagug = tamix-norys-ulaix-joreth-druius-jorael-briax-prair-lamael-caseth-brivan-lamius-istius